My properties palatte disappeared. I tried changing workspaces and it doesn't show in any of them.
I tried changing profiles and nothing. I can click on the icon on the quick command toolbar and nothing. I can double click on any item and nothing.
I also tried highlighting something and right click to and clicked on properties and nothing.
I went to the CUI and tried different settings, and nothing. I'm not sure what to do next.

Try moving your cursor very close to the left or right edge of the screen and see if you can 'pull' the property palette out of the edge. Sometimes the palette will shrink to a very very small thin line and you cannot tell that it is even present. It has happened to me a few times before i figured out what had happened.
Another thing that I do that has success is to go into the profile file and modify the location and size of the property palette. You can find your profiles at the link below.
C:\Users\<USER>\AppData\Roaming\Autodesk\MEP 20XX\enu\Support\Profiles
I just had an issue where I couldnt find the properties palette and had to go into the profile so i could see where it was located. That is when i noticed that the Height and Width were both set to 0. I closed out of AutoCAD MEP, changed the value of Width and Height, saved the file and then restarted AutoCAD MEP and then the palette was visible.
